United KingdomBeds are comfortable and the rooms are spacious. Some things could do with refurbishing e.g. curtains and blinds which have wear and tear, grouting on the tub needs replaced. We struggled with communicating with staff as many did not speak English, so come prepared to use a translator app to make your life easier. It's fairly removed from central attractions but easy enough to get places. Taxis are always outside and are cheap in Macau (again, translate your address to Chinese to show them). Our highlight was the walk up to the Guia Lighthouse which you can see from the hotel!

United KingdomBreakfast was poor quality and not good value for money. Temperature in the hotel was too cold on the corridors with AC on very strong. The reception service was quite slow at both check-in and check out. The bathroom was a disaster. Every time I used the shower, regardless of using the curtain/screen, the bathroom floor flooded.
Location was near the outer harbour so walking distance to the ferry for HK. Was able to check in early as the room was ready. Tea making facilities in the room. Cleaning staff very kind and efficient. Swimming pool was great and open until 9pm. Gym was fairly well equipped but I didnt use it. Reliable WiFi. Many nearby cafes and grocery stores.
